mysql存储过程编写 mysql存储过程定义数组

本文目录一览:

  • 1、MySQL创建存储过程
  • 2、如何向mysql的一个字段写入数组?
  • 3、mysql中怎么存储数组
  • 4、mysql中怎么存储数组?在线等!急!
MySQL创建存储过程打开mysql的客户端管理软件 , 找到想要创建存储过程的数据库,在【Stored Procedures】菜单上点击鼠标右键,选择【Create Stored Procedure】菜单项 。
用户创建的存储过程是由用户创建并完成某一特定功能的存储过程,事实上一般所说的存储过程就是指本地存储过程 。
只要将以上代码在“查询分析器”里执行一次 , SQL SERVER就会在当前数据库中创建一个名为“upGetUserName”的存储过程 。
如何向mysql的一个字段写入数组?必须保证被更新字段的类型是字符型;被更新的值需要用包裹起来 。
先将从数据库中取出的内容,按所属字段赋值给字符串变量(字符串变量的个数等于您取出内容包含的字段数目;定义数组;3 。根据字符串变量的个数为循环语句设置循环条件;执行循环语句 , 为数组的每个成员赋值 。
首先打开MYSQL的管理工具 , 新建一个test表,并且在表中插入两个字段 。接下来在Editplus编辑器中创建一个PHP文件,进行数据库连接,并且选择要操作的数据库 。然后通过mysql_query方法执行一个Insert的插入语句 。
跟关系型mysql数据存储持久化没有关系 。如果你要将数组的内容存储的mysql中 , 如 arr[n][m]二维数组 , 你创建一个table arr ,  列是 A B , 循环数组的每个元素,然后存储到对应的表中的A B列 。
创建数据库,就如下图所示一样 。根据学生编号批量删除学生信息 , 如下图所示 。声明初始化变量,看到以下画面 。获取传入参数数组长度,创建临时表,所输入的如下图所示 。
mysql中怎么存储数组PHP查询到的数据存放到数组里面,一般使用$arr[]=$row的方式实现 , $row是mysql_fetch_array获得的一行数据,本身是一个数组,执行上面的语句之后,这一行会添加存放在额为数组$arr的最后 。
在test.php文件内,创建一条查询data数据表所有数据的sql语句,再使用mysqli_query执行sql语句 。
json_encode() 函数的功能是将数值转换成json数据存储格式 。
因为后面有空格,11`22`33也一样!俺你的规则应该变成AB1`2`311`22`33这样才对吧!不过数据最好是以最简单的方式存储 , 像你这样的话,把数据搞的很复杂 。以数组的方式存储比较好 。
可用substring函数 。如某个表中只有一个字段:ID 123abc 456def 890ghi 现在要将前三位为一个字段,起名为id1 , 后3位是另一个字段,起名叫id2 。
mysql中怎么存储数组?在线等!急!当然怎么存储到数据库中看你自己的需要,可以存到一个字段中,用分隔符分开,倒是取出来的时候直接字符串split得到数组 。
你可以把它存到nvarchar中 。比如一个数组[1,2,3,4,5]你存到数据库中就是1,2,3,4,5 你读取的时候在把它放到数组中不就可以了 。
UPDATE TeacherInfo set PhoneNumber = [1234 , 1254];必须保证被更新字段的类型是字符型;被更新的值需要用包裹起来 。
【mysql存储过程编写 mysql存储过程定义数组】第一步|第二步,把这个合并后的字符串存入数据库你是会的 。从数据库里面取出合并后的字符串第一步|第二步以后,利用split方法可以转换为数组 。这个方法的最大的优点是可以保存个数不确定的数组,程序编写相当简单 。

    推荐阅读